How to repair a uPVC door handle

It's time to replace panel in upvc door your uPVC door handle. You'll need to repair it to ensure your home remains secure and safe.

There are several reasons your uPVC door handle may be damaged or stuck. In general, this problem is caused by a spring inside the door handle. To prevent future problems, it is recommended to replace the worn spring.

A damaged latch could be the reason why your uPVC door handle becomes slow. This could be a sign of a broken spring or a defective gearbox.

Repairing a floppy uPVC door handle isn't difficult and isn't expensive. You can call an expert to help you or try to repair it yourself.

First, remove the door handle. To do this, pull off the screws that keep the casing in place. Next, pull out the handles on the outside and inside from the door. You can then lift the lock mechanism upwards by taking off the handle. You'll then be able see the spring cassettes, escutcheon plates and the handle itself.

After you've pulled the handle from the door, you'll have to measure the length of the handle. This is essential to ensure that your new handle will cover the space in which the handle was.

Next, you'll need to attach the new handle. To put in the spindle as well as the handle make sure you use a gentle and soft hand. You will also need an screwdriver.
